Cyclone Remal Live Updates: Cyclonic storm "Remal" is currently situated over the North Bay of Bengal, progressing northwards at a velocity of 16 kmph. The storm is anticipated to make landfall within the next few hours, according to India Meteorological Department (IMD).
"The severe cyclonic storm "Remal" (pronounced as "Re-Mal") over the North Bay of Bengal moved nearly northwards, with a speed of 16 kmph during past 06 hours and lay centered at 1730 hrs IST of today, the 26th May, 2024, over the same region near latitude 21.15°N and longitude 89.2°E about 125 km east-southeast of Sagar Islands (West Bengal), 140 km southwest of Khepupara (Bangladesh), 135 km south-southeast of Canning (West Bengal) and 155 km south-southwest of Mongla (Bangladesh)," IMD said in a statement.
Cyclone Remal LIVE: Over 1 lakh people in Bengal's coastal areas shifted to shelters
As a precautionary measure against impending severe cyclone 'Remal', the West Bengal government has evacuated over 1.10 lakh people from coastal regions, including the Sundarbans and Sagar Island, to secure shelters, a senior official said on Sunday.
To bolster these efforts, 16 battalions each from the state disaster management and NDRF have been deployed in the coastal areas, the official added."Evacuation efforts have concentrated on relocating 1.10 lakh people from coastal regions to safe shelters, with a significant number hailing from South 24 Parganas district, notably Sagar Island, Sunderbans, and Kakdwip," the official informed PTI.
Severe cyclone Remal will cross between the coasts of West Bengal and Bangladesh on Sunday midnight. Extremely heavy rain has been predicted in the coastal districts of West Bengal, north Odisha and parts of northeast India from May 26-28.
A low-pressure system over the Bay of Bengal intensified into severe cyclonic storm Remal and is expected to make landfall between the coasts of West Bengal and Bangladesh at midnight on Sunday, the India Meteorological Department (IMD) said.
Remal, which means sand in Arabic, is the first pre-monsoon cyclone in the Bay of Bengal this season. The name was provided by Oman, following the regional naming system for cyclones in the north Indian Ocean.
According to the weather department, extremely heavy rainfall has been predicted in the coastal districts of West Bengal and north Odisha on May 26 and 27. Parts of northeast India may also witness extremely heavy rainfall due to the impact of Remal on May 27 and 28.
